Superintendent - K12
Manage all aspects of K12 construction projects, including planning, scheduling, and budgeting.
Ensure compliance with safety regulations and company standards on-site.
Coordinate with subcontractors, vendors, and stakeholders to maintain project timelines.
Conduct regular site inspections to monitor progress and address any issues promptly.
Communicate effectively with project teams, school representatives, and local authorities.
Maintain detailed project documentation, including reports, schedules, and change orders.
Lead project meetings to discuss progress, challenges, and solutions.
Drive quality assurance and ensure all work meets specified requirements.
